To achieve optimal results with the <产品名字>, a specific material composition is recommended. The following table outlines the standard mix design and the resulting product performance metrics, ensuring bricks meet or exceed ASTM C936 and other international standards for solid concrete interlocking paving units.
| Material Component | Specification / Grade | Typical Proportion by Volume | Purpose in Mix |
|---|---|---|---|
| Coarse Aggregate | Crushed Stone, 6mm - 10mm, ASTM C33 | 70% - 80% | Creates interconnected pore structure |
| Cement | Portland Cement Type I/II | 15% - 20% | Binder for strength and durability |
| Water | Potable, w/c Ratio 0.28 - 0.34 | 4% - 6% | Hydration and workability |
| Admixtures | Polymer / NSF-certified (Optional) | 0.5% - 1.5% | Enhance strength, reduce water demand |
| Performance Characteristic | Test Method | Standard Result |
|---|---|---|
| Compressive Strength | ASTM C140 | > 35 MPa (5000 psi) |
| Permeability Rate | ASTM C1701 | 0.12 - 0.35 cm/sec |
| Abrasion Resistance | ASTM C944 | < 15 mm depth of wear |
| Freeze-Thaw Durability | ASTM C1645 | < 10% mass loss after 50 cycles |
